# Brindlehop Environments

Brindlehop wraps the upstream Cartograph API with a circuit breaker, and each environment tunes it differently — staging trips fast on purpose so we notice flakiness early, while prod is more forgiving. Don't copy prod values into staging; we've been burned by that twice. The per-environment breaker settings currently in effect are listed below.

settings of yageg-yahap:
[gorael]
team = olieth
access_code = ac_941d74
owner = brieth.aldiel
host = gorael.tolvaqio.internal
port = 6379
peer = briwyn.urlaqtech.internal
salt = 116e6622
pin = 1957

Changelog — Quartmill map service v2.9. Added a tile-rendering cache layer in front of the rasterizer, keyed on zoom + style hash, which cuts p95 render time roughly in half on the Dunsby cluster. Heads up for reviewers: cache invalidation piggybacks on the style-publish event, so stale tiles can linger for up to 30 seconds after a style push — we decided that's acceptable for now and documented it inline. Eviction is plain LRU, 4GB cap, configurable. Questions about the invalidation tradeoff should go to:

approver of bagug-bagag = Holael Pramir

Quick excerpt from the Burrowpipe compaction doc before Thursday's sync: compaction runs per-partition, picking segments whose dead-record ratio crosses a threshold, then merging them into fresh segments while readers keep the old ones pinned. The tricky bit is pacing — compact too eagerly and we starve consumer I/O, too lazily and disk fills up on the Harkwell cluster again. We landed on these knobs after two weeks of soak testing:

tuning table, faweg-bajep:
WEIGHTS = {
    "belius": 690,
    "eliox": 458,
    "norax": 616,
    "praion": 132,
    "zorvan": 911,
}

The Orvane Labs bike cage and the east and west parking gates operate on separate access schedules, and facilities desk staff should note that visitor vehicles may only use the west gate between 07:00 and 19:00. Cyclists requesting cage access must show a valid day pass, and their details should be entered in the access ledger before the cage is opened. Gates must never be propped open, even briefly, during deliveries. When a manual override is required at either gate, use the code below.

staff pass of fadup-fawig = bdg-FUNKS-4